When searching for new music, I usually click on a few random track samples. 10-secs of so of each is usually enough to turn me off or draw me in for further listening. Perhaps short-sighted, but usually serves me well when sorting music into like / dislike.

 

This is a technique that failed me completely with VHS (and I suspect others too); portions of abrasive cut-up sampling of vintage sounds sent me walking on to the next ridiculously-over-hyped Boomkat release. With tracks such as Franco Zoom taking two full minutes to fully settle down, I think this can be forgivable.

 

It wasn't until hearing the the clips of 'Sunset Everett' (and subsequently 'Seen Enough') over in the Music Discussion forum that I was really hooked (thanks Green Kingdom - you've given me a permanent grin for the past couple of weeks :wink:).

 

The sample-jack-offs are actually something that I've come to like. Hearing sounds that don't align properly before they 'click' into place is a fantastic technique. It's like wondering "What's going on?" in a club before being smashed in the face with filth – fantastic.

 

Repeating as others have said - don't miss this academy award winner.
